Three Exclusive Ted Talks on Transcending Times of Challenge, Embodying Leadership, and Bringing Inclusive Change to Drive Success
Potomac Ballroom A & B
In-Person Friday 11/18/2022 04:30 PM - 05:30 PM   Add to calendar

Doors open at 4:00 PM.

In today’s complex workplace landscape, organizational leadership calls for a multitude of skills, traits and approaches. As Volunteer Leaders, you face continued monumental undertakings during these crucial times as the world and the workplace shift into overdrive.

This session features three varied perspectives on how to rise above various challenges – and thrive as volunteers. Four-time Olympian, Ruben Gonzales, examines how the pathway to achievement starts with letting go of our fear-based control and individualism and becoming vulnerable. Strategic advisor and communications executive Denise Graziano points to the critical communications elements enabling leaders to navigate crisis and gain ground despite the circumstances. Finally, Eric Ellis, a leading voice on workplace culture, explores how culture can drive organizational achievement, and how you can bring inclusion to your workplace – but to your State Council or Chapter as well.

In these approachable, intimate and engaging talks, drill down on critical aspects and key strategies that will make a difference in your role as a Volunteer Leader and leave you with practical, applicable strategies on how to not only meet your challenges but also thrive in a turbulent environment – within your State Council or Chapter AND your workplace.
